Output 5ae4f76bafeb868ebaefb5564db7258a3725aeeefadfdb4f56505643020c7818:8

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 860fcb571c89ac2253b45de71f73e608e56fe43e OP_EQUAL
address
3DusPf1LzH7vZBDZYDjmFaTZohscwt6KvB
transaction
5ae4f76bafeb868ebaefb5564db7258a3725aeeefadfdb4f56505643020c7818
spent
true